Skip to Content

Turtle nest on Gerakas Beach in Zakynthos, Greece Photo:Heatheronhertravels.com

Turtle nest on Gerakas Beach in Zakynthos, Greece Photo:Heatheronhertravels.com

Turtle nest on Gerakas Beach in Zakynthos, Greece Photo:Heatheronhertravels.com